Abstract

This paper uses Poincaré formalism to extend the Levi-Civita theorem to cope with nonholonomic systems admitting certain invariant relations whose equations of motion involve constraint multipliers. Sufficient conditions allowing such extension are obtained and, as an application of the theory a generalization of Routh's motion is presented.
